Durham Food Policy Council aims to protect Durham’s agricultural land

The Durham Food Policy Council (DFPC) is a community-based committee in the Region of Durham that was established in early 2010. The members of the DFPC have strong concerns about proposed plans pertaining to land use contained in Region of Durham’s Official Plan, especially those that have implications for local agricultural lands and future initiatives for local food security. The DFPC will continue to promote prudent use of the agricultural lands until this becomes a priority for the Region of Durham. The group invites concerned citizens to join the movement in seeing that food and sustainable planning become a priority by the Region of Durham for the benefit of residents and Durham Region as a whole.
